如果不对其进行显式转换,后续的比较操作可能会按照字符串的规则而非数值的规则进行,从而产生意想不到的结果。
这种方法适用于添加简单的文本字段,例如电话号码、城市或自定义描述等。
主goroutine使用select语句同时监听done channel和time.After channel。
src目录下的所有模块共同构成一个包。
这个Base DN通常是你的Active Directory域的根(例如DC=yourdomain,DC=local)或特定的OU。
攻击者可以构造恶意序列化字符串,利用PHP对象注入(POP链)来触发任意代码执行。
添加注释:对于复杂的lambda函数,应该添加注释来解释其功能。
总结 通过Pusher,我们成功地解决了Laravel后端向React前端发送实时通知的问题。
Python中使用lxml库示例: 商汤商量 商汤科技研发的AI对话工具,商量商量,都能解决。
本文旨在解决在使用AJAX动态填充Select标签时遇到的数据无法显示问题。
例如,以下实体结构:type Product struct { Name string Related []*datastore.Key // 存储关联产品的键切片 }如果尝试查找所有 Related 切片中包含特定 datastore.Key 的 Product,Datastore无法直接提供此类索引或查询功能,导致无法在不遍历所有 Product 实体的情况下完成查询。
下面是一个简洁、实用且线程安全的线程池设计与实现方式。
并发性:在生产环境中执行此类操作时,应考虑并发写入的可能性。
该组合在微服务场景下高效稳定,开发求快,生产求稳。
本文深入探讨Go语言中生成全局唯一标识符(UUID)的最佳实践。
Kivy 规则通常会将其转换为小写并移除 App 后缀来匹配 .kv 文件名(例如 BookkeepingApp 对应 bookkeeping.kv),但对于自定义的 Widget 类,直接匹配其类名至关重要。
依赖注入的三种常见方式 在PHP中,依赖注入主要有以下三种形式: 依图语音开放平台 依图语音开放平台 6 查看详情 构造函数注入:最常用的方式,依赖通过构造方法传入。
静态成员变量:类的“共享储物柜” 定义与初始化 立即学习“C++免费学习笔记(深入)”; 静态成员变量属于类本身,而不是类的任何特定对象。
通过runtime.Stack()获取goroutine堆栈快照,可排查卡死、高延迟或泄漏问题,是定位并发异常的关键步骤。
总结与最佳实践 方法签名精确匹配: Go语言要求实现接口的方法签名(包括参数类型和返回类型)必须与接口定义的方法签名完全一致。
本文链接:http://www.ensosoft.com/11846_3096a7.html